Mixed feelings
The pros: The location and views of the hotel was amazing. We kept laughing at the fact that it seemed that everything we ended up going was literally 5 minutes away.
The basics were also just right, the shower was amazing and the bed leant it self to a very restful sleep.
The cons: The cleanliness/cleaning of the room was disappointing. Dust seemed to be everywhere. There was mold growing on the second floor stairs. The bed had some previous tenants vape laying under the bed on my final inspection to see if anything was left. And to top it all of the towels. Now maybe I'm just being overly demanding, but from the handbook, the towels were only set to be changed if I was staying longer than 12 days. Although we just managed to deal with the towel situation for the 3 nights that we did stay, that made me cringe when laying under the fur throws that were in the room, as I doubt the cleaning schedule of those sheets between guests...
The facility seemed incomplete. The air-conditioning ( I actually believe that it was underfloor heating) was confusing to understand and ended up turning the room into a drafty fridge, or a sauna with no inbetween. The lamps in the bedroom didn't work, with one of them missing a lightbulb, and the other one would only blink to life for a second before fading back into darkness. And finally, the bedroom seemed to be missing a door. Although not critical, it did leave us a little cautious and worried when in the bed, as the view was pretty much a straight line to the windows of the building adjacent to the hotel.
Overall, the experience and the price didn't quite line up as a whole, and I can't say that we'd be visiting Coney Street anytime soon.
